However, caution is required when working with stretchy fabrics or curved surfaces like caps. If you plan to use this for sweatshirt embroidery on a knit fabric, you must pair it with a high-quality cutaway stabilizer. Without proper stabilization, the movement of the fabric during wear could distort the dolphin's tail or snout over time. Similarly, if you attempt to place this on a structured cap, the curvature of the front panel might compress the design. In those cases, simplifying the internal details and increasing the spacing between stitch lines is crucial to maintain clarity.
Technical Considerations for Digitizing
Since the Beach Dolphin Ocean Summer Svg Png is provided as a cutting file and printable clipart, it does not come with pre-set stitch counts or hoop requirements. This is a vital distinction for Etsy sellers and craft business owners. You are buying the artwork, not the finished embroidery file. Before promising a client a finished product, you need to digitize it yourself or hire a professional digitizer. When doing so, pay close attention to the small details. Tiny fins or splashes of water that look crisp in a PNG can become a nightmare of thread breaks if they are too small for your needle size.
- Thread Colors: Stick to a limited palette. Two or three shades of blue plus white usually suffice to create depth without over-complicating the stitch map.
- Hoop Size: Ensure your chosen hoop accommodates the full width of the dolphin, especially if you plan to add text like "Summer Vibes" underneath.
- Fabric Texture: Always test on scrap fabric that matches your final product. A design that looks great on smooth quilting cotton might disappear on a textured waffle weave.
- Stitch Types: Consider using a running stitch for fine details like water droplets to reduce bulk, reserving fill stitches for the main body of the dolphin.

It is also worth noting the licensing terms. While the product description mentions it is an instant digital download suitable for commercial use in many contexts, always double-check the specific license regarding commercial embroidery. Some creators allow the sale of physical items but restrict the resale of the digitized embroidery file itself. Protecting your business means understanding these boundaries before listing your finished product on marketplaces.
